Webb6 dec. 2016 · A passenger vehicle typically has 55-60% of its weight on the front wheels and 40-45% on the rears. But pickup trucks are designed to carry loads. So as little as 30-35% of the vehicle’s weight is on the rear wheels when it's empty, to allow for the addition of a load in the rear. Therein lies a problem, for both two and four-wheel-drive ... Webb15 dec. 2024 · For best traction in winter you want a greater percentage of the vehicle’s weight centered over the drive wheels. ... A general rule of thumb is 240-300 pounds for a ½-ton pickup and 300-400 pounds for a ¾ to a 1-ton pickup.
